Output e6d2abc157e6de62880d397b458f5d6de2e4ba41aab7bdc29aa9aa7cd44fdf8b:1

value
1184302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3656308913a37b38540b8cda3a91ce5c71fa660a OP_EQUAL
address
36eKfTf4ywfHyg3sQFs7LHup6RDYqFUHg9
transaction
e6d2abc157e6de62880d397b458f5d6de2e4ba41aab7bdc29aa9aa7cd44fdf8b
confirmations
31656
spent
true